The original recipe serves 8 people and requires 3/4 cup of sugar. To find the amount of sugar needed for 22 people, we can set up a proportion:
(3/4 cup sugar) / (8 people) = (x cups sugar) / (22 people)
Cross-multiply and solve for x:
3/4 * 22 = 8x
66/4 = 8x
x = 66/32
x = 2.0625 cups
So, Prahar would need approximately 2.0625 cups of sugar for a serving size of 22 people.
